{"product_id":"biolegend-150302","title":"Biolegend, 150302, Purified anti-mouse CD198 (CCR8) Antibody, 100μg","description":"\u003cp\u003eC-C chemokine receptor type 8 (CCR8) CD198, is a 41 kD G-protein coupled receptor with 7 transmembrane regions. CCR8 is expressed by a subset of thymocytes, Tregs, NKT and Th2-polarized cells, a subset of macrophages, monocytes, and monocyte-derived dendritic cells.
